Manipur Police Clarify Shantipur Firing Incident

Manipur Police have issued a clarification regarding the sequence of events that led to the firing incident at Shantipur in Kangpokpi district.

In an official statement, police said the shutdown call followed an incident in which a man sustained bullet injuries after allegedly failing to stop his vehicle despite repeated signals from security personnel at a naka (checkpoint).

According to police, the incident took place on April 8, 2026, at around 9:30 PM near Kanglatongbi Bridge. A Chevrolet Cruze carrying three occupants and an Alto car with a single occupant had reportedly converged at the location for a test drive and vehicle exchange. During the process, the Cruze met with a minor accident after falling into a nearby nullah.

Police personnel stationed at a security naka near Kanglatongbi Hindi High School in Shantipur rushed to the spot to assist. At the same time, the accompanying Alto car allegedly approached the checkpoint at high speed, ignored repeated signals to stop, and nearly hit security personnel on duty.

On noticing police presence, the Alto’s occupant reportedly attempted to flee towards Kangpokpi.
Citing imminent risk and suspicious behaviour, security forces fired controlled rounds aimed at the tyres to stop the vehicle. However, the vehicle did not halt and continued to escape.

Police later confirmed that the Alto driver, identified as Lenkhogin Tuboi, sustained bullet injuries and was taken to Mission Hospital in Kangpokpi, where he is currently undergoing treatment.

Meanwhile, the driver of the Chevrolet Cruze, identified as 21-year-old Janggingen Khongsai, was detained and handed over to G. Saparmeina Police Station. He was later released after due formalities.

An FIR has been registered in connection with the incident, and further investigation is underway. Police reiterated their commitment to maintaining law and order and urged the public to remain calm, assuring that necessary steps are being taken to ensure transparency and peace in the region.
